Difficulty of Temple of Atzoatl

What depend on difficulty of Temple of Atzoatl? I have played 3 times. Every time temple was based on tier 6-7 maps that I was played due to the Navi missions.
Problem is that those three times was representing different difficulty level. Once I have been crossed whole temple without problem, another times I was dying because single monster hit. Every time temple was containing same type of monsters without mods (due to no mod maps) so... why difficulty of that temple might be so different? What it is depend on?

It depends on three things
1 - The level of the temple, which is based usually on the highest map you did while setting it up. If you joined a friend for a T15 map and did a temple incursion there, harder temple.

2 - The temple room setup - did you buff monster speed, or damage, etc?

3 - Random mob appearance. Some are harder than others and will just gang up on you at the wrong time. There are some major chaos ones that can oneshot you. You will find them in some temples but not others. This is really just random.

That's not even close to the computation.

It's "average level of incursions done + 10, capped at the highest level incursion you completed". So, the reason it's capped at 83 is that you can't find an incursion higher than 83.

If you hypothetically did 11 alva missions in t1 and 1 in t16 (yes, wasting a mission because you hypothetically skipped the last alva in one of your first 4 missions), you would get a level 79 temple.
also, pay attention when you decide how you will upgrade a room in an incursion. Upgrading a room to tier 2 or 3 often means all the mobs in the finished temple get a major combat boost or YOU get a fat nerf to your resistances.

Look at a good incursion strategy guide to sort out what kinds of mods you can deal with and what you would rather take a pass on. While it's nice to be offered a chance to ride an incursion all the way to tier 3 everything, you are the one who has to clean up that mess once the temple is ready.

Unlike maps, you can't roll a mod for a temple that gives you say, temp chains or enfeeble. These are annoying but won't kill you. The only mods left, of course, are the ones that can make temples super rippy. More damage, power/frenzy charges, fatter ass, bigger monster packs, more rares, chance for them to be possessed by a torment or corrupted or both, plentiful non-poison chaos flying around, phasing/flicker monsters, leeching and regen at your expense.

Mechanics
After 12 incursions, Alva Valai will open a portal to the temple. The temple contains different rooms inside a single area. The area level of the temple is determined by the average level of zones a player opened incursions in plus 10 levels, capped at the highest level of one of incursion the player did open.

For example a player opened:

3 incursion at area level 72
3 incursions at area level 75
3 incursions at area level 79
3 incursion at area level 80
equals an average of area level 76 plus 10 levels, would result in temple level 86. However, since the highest level zone completed is level 80, the temple level changes to that.
